Cut the beans & kitchen work

Let the kids work with knife to cut vegetables.

Cutting vegetables is not only a help in the kitchen but it also is a life skill.

It lets kids do positive multi-tasking.

It allows a time to light chat, friendship, & bonding.




Similarly when kids learn to make paratha, they know the struggle so eating it gets easier even at breakfast early in the morning.

Plaster of Paris Art

1.     Make a paste of plaster of paris using water.
2.     Put the paste in selected molds like hearts, flowers.
3.     Leave it for at least 1 hour.
4.     Take out the dried shapes out of the molds.
5.     Paint with various colors.
6.     Let the paint dry.
7.     The beautiful art pieces are ready.
8.     These can be used as paper weights or decoration.

Kids health and food art

Is eating time a struggle?

Let your kids get nutrition through food art. Helping children love their food is one of the best gift you can offer to your child.  

Let the kids have some creative 'me time' while they get nutrition. Let them snack on fruits & veggies instead of packaged junk.

Let the kids be involved with simple food preparation as they learn focus, grip, precision, and coordination skills while using the knife.

DO NOT make food time a SCREEN TIME! It will ruin your children's love of food and will deteriorate their health.
